**Ticket: Firmware channel drift on Hollowbeam devices**

Heads up for the sync: the Hollowbeam update channels have drifted again — a chunk of the field fleet is pulling from the beta channel instead of stable. Looks like a provisioning script override that never got reverted. We should pin channel assignment in config rather than scripts. The intended channel settings are these.

deployment values, yadug-bawif:
[framir]
team = pelox
access_code = ac_a38ab2
owner = tamion.julael
host = framir.tolvaqlabs.test
port = 11211
peer = tammir.zemvargrid.local
salt = 2215ef03
pin = 1541

## Changelog — DiffScope 4.2.1 (key rotation)

This release rotates the signing key for DiffScope, our large-file diff viewer, following the scheduled annual rotation. No functional changes are included. Verification of 4.2.0 and earlier continues to work via the archived key in the trust bundle. All artifacts from 4.2.1 onward, including the streaming-chunk renderer, are signed with the new key below.

release key, fahop-bahip: bky19_PspfQHRyvVcYD9LdZgo

## Deploying the Gatewick Proctor Queue

Deploys are pretty painless: push to main, wait for the pipeline, then watch the queue drain dashboard for five minutes. If candidates pile up mid-exam, roll back first and ask questions later — the queue replays safely. Everything the workers care about lives in one config block, shown here for reference.

settings of bafof-yagef:
JOROX_PIN=8740
JOROX_TENANT=pelox
JOROX_METRICS_HOST=metrics.jorox.qorvelworks.internal
JOROX_SEAL=seal_c78f63c1
JOROX_STANDBY_TEAM=norax

## Deployment Notes — Flaky Integration Tests

Tillgate's payment integration tests flake under parallel runs. Cause: shared sandbox ledger state. Mitigation: serialized payment suites, retries capped at two, quarantine list reviewed weekly. Support: if a deploy is blocked on a quarantined test, escalate rather than rerun. Do not edit the test environment directly. Deploys currently run against the following settings.

settings of kagup-tagug:
ULAIX_HOST=ulaix.zemvarsys.internal
ULAIX_PORT=8000